Women’s Tennis Falls to University of Puget Sound

In their continued competition against the rigors of four-year universities, Bellevue College women’s tennis fell 6-0 on Friday to the University of Puget Sound in Tacoma. The Bulldogs lost in straight sets in all six matches but #2 singles Ashlyn Hohn put up a good fight in an 8-4 loss to UPS’s Zoe Love. Hohn teamed with Bellevue’s Mila Sidhu as Bellevue’s #1 singles falling 8-3. Here are the results from Friday’s match.

The Bulldogs will get a break until a league-opening match on Saturday March 7 against Spokane. First serve is set for 9:00 a.m. at the Bellevue Tennis (Gorin Academy) Center.
